Materials and Design: Built for the Grind
The core is high-purity quartz, because it transmits that short-wave UVC cleanly and handles the jolt of startup heat without cracking. Inside, the coating and fill gas are tuned to keep UVC output steady, even when the lamp cycles on and off a lot. And the R7s connector? That was a practical call. It locks in fast, tool-free, and keeps the contact consistent. On a line that never stops, that translates to less downtime and fewer maintenance headaches.
What It Does for You: Mold Control, No Waiting
At 254nm, UVC disrupts mold DNA and stops it from spreading—on surfaces and in the air.
